About the 87B District Court
The 87B District Court is a single-judge trial court serving Kalkaska County in Michigan. Located at 605 N Birch St, Kalkaska, MI 49646, the court operates with 1 judge and handles misdemeanor criminal offenses, civil infractions, traffic violations, small claims disputes, and landlord-tenant matters.
